#a44763 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a44763 is composed of 64.3% red, 27.8%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 56.7% magenta, 39.6%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 341.9 degrees, a saturation of 39.6% and a lightness of 46.1%. #a44763 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8ec6 with #490000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

● #a44763 color description : Dark moderate pink.
#a44763 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a44763 has RGB values of R:164, G:71,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.57, Y:0.4,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10766179.
